Portable Charger for Galaxy S24 Ultra Buying Guide

Capacity

Capacity refers to the amount of energy a portable charger can store. It’s measured in milliampere-hours (mAh). A higher mAh rating means the power bank can charge your Galaxy S24 Ultra more times before needing to be recharged itself. This is crucial for extended trips or when you’re far from a power outlet.

Why it matters is simple: you don’t want to be caught with a dead phone. For the S24 Ultra, which has a substantial battery, a higher capacity is generally better. Look for chargers with at least 10,000mAh for a couple of full charges. For frequent travelers, 20,000mAh or more offers peace of mind.

Charging Speed

Charging speed determines how quickly the portable charger can replenish your Galaxy S24 Ultra’s battery. This is primarily dictated by the charger’s output wattage and supported charging protocols, such as USB Power Delivery (PD) and Qualcomm Quick Charge. Faster charging means less downtime for your phone.

The S24 Ultra supports fast charging technologies. To take full advantage, your portable charger must also support these. Look for chargers with at least 25W PD output. Higher wattage (e.g., 45W or more) can offer even faster charging, though the S24 Ultra’s maximum charging speed might be capped. Check the charger’s specifications for PD compatibility.

Portability and Size

Portability and size are vital for a device meant to be carried around. A portable charger should be easy to slip into a pocket, bag, or backpack without adding excessive bulk or weight. The physical dimensions and weight directly impact its convenience for daily use or travel.

The ideal size balances battery capacity with ease of transport. Smaller, lighter chargers are great for everyday carry, while larger capacity units might be a bit bulkier but offer more charges. Consider your typical usage scenarios. If you travel light, prioritize a compact model. If you need multiple charges, a slightly larger unit might be acceptable.

Build Quality and Safety Features

Build quality refers to the materials used and the overall construction of the portable charger. Safety features are paramount to protect both the charger and your valuable Galaxy S24 Ultra from damage. Reputable brands invest in robust designs and safety certifications.

A well-built charger will withstand daily wear and tear. Safety features to look for include overcharge protection, short-circuit protection, and temperature control. These prevent overheating, which can damage your phone’s battery or the charger itself. Look for chargers that comply with safety standards like UL certification for added assurance.

Does the S24 Ultra Support Fast Charging with Portable Chargers?

Yes, the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ra supports fast charging technologies. It is compatible with USB Power Delivery (PD) and Samsung’s own Super Fast Charging. To benefit from these speeds, your portable charger must also support these protocols. Look for chargers advertising high wattage output, such as 25W or 45W PD.

Using a portable charger that matches or exceeds your phone’s fast charging capabilities will significantly reduce charging times. Without proper support, your S24 Ultra will charge much slower. Always check the charger’s specifications for PD compatibility and wattage to ensure optimal performance.

Are All USB-C Portable Chargers Compatible with the S24 Ultra?

While most USB-C chargers will physically connect, compatibility for charging speed varies. The S24 Ultra supports specific fast charging standards. A basic USB-C charger might only provide a trickle charge. You need a charger that supports USB Power Delivery (PD) to achieve fast charging speeds.

Ensure the portable charger explicitly states support for USB PD and the wattage it offers. Chargers without PD will still charge your phone, but at a much slower rate. It’s worth investing in a PD-compatible charger to maximize your S24 Ultra’s charging efficiency and minimize waiting time.

Can a Portable Charger Damage My S24 Ultra’s Battery?

A high-quality portable charger with proper safety features should not damage your S24 Ultra’s battery. Reputable chargers are designed to regulate voltage and current, preventing overcharging and overheating. These are the main culprits behind battery degradation. Always use certified chargers from trusted manufacturers.

However, using a faulty or uncertified charger can indeed pose a risk. These chargers may not have adequate protection circuits, leading to excessive heat or improper charging, which can harm your phone’s battery over time. Stick to well-known brands and look for safety certifications to ensure the longevity of your S24 Ultra’s battery.
